The Oresteia review " visceral in every sense | Kate Kellaway by Kate Kellaway

Shakespeare's Globe, London By the end of the second play, two bloodbaths down and hoping for a cathartic finish, the viewer is reelingWe have had Robert Icke's celebrated version of The Oresteia at the Almeida (transferring to Trafalgar Studios) and Blanche McIntyre's revival of Ted Hughes's translation comes to Manchester next month.
